Hey folks, it’s Wes from DinkLife. I took a snowy trip back in time at the Crawford Auto-Aviation Museum in Cleveland. It’s been about eight years since my last visit, and walking in felt like diving into a treasure chest of automotive history.
From a towering Indian motorcycle sign to a model of the Terminal Tower lit up in style, there were gems everywhere. They even had a special Mustang exhibit on display, including a Super Snake with a killer paint job and patriotic flair. I geeked out over the CityCar from 1975 — one of the earliest electric cars — and the iconic DeLorean that brought all the 80s vibes.
It wasn’t just the cars that told stories. I found myself lost in Goodyear history, admiring murals of old amusement parks and storefronts that took me back in time. The museum’s mix of history, nostalgia, and sheer automotive beauty made this snowy day in Ohio a memorable one.
